Our Process

To create our tiles, Jess digitally hand-paints her designs layer by layer, using watercolour methods primarily and then adding fine detail with calligraphy style markers. These designs are then printed using sublimation ink and heat pressed onto ceramic, transferring the image into the tile, giving the beauty of hand painted tiles with the durability afforded by a modern method.
